This petition has been filed by the petitioner praying for the following relief: “a) Pass any appropriate writ/order/direction to direct Respondent No.1&2 to provide age relaxation to the petitioner by relaxing 03 months and 12 days as a one-time measure and allow him to participate in the selection process without being barred for being Signature Not Verified Digitally Signed WP(C) 3102/2025 Page 1 of 4 By:RENUKA NEGI Signing Date:19.03.2025 13:25:29 overage as per the impugned advertisement (M.O.S.B-2024). b) Pass any appropriate writ/order/direction to direct Respondents to allow Petitioner to appear for the interview scheduled on 12.03.2025 for the post of Medical Officers (Assistant Commandant).” 3. It is the case of the petitioner that the petitioner is a qualified doctor currently employed as Medical Officer on contractual basis with Neyveli Uttar Pradesh Power Ltd. He belongs to the Other Backward Class (Non-creamy Layer Category).
